In 2004, Ambush once again launches upgraded, high quality TRUE DAY NIGHT (TDN) cameras. At the moment our main focus is strongly on reliability, which we believe is the most important quality for security products. By 2003, Ambush's TDN mechanism was based on filter change by small motor that control the light amount going in and out, and also other external influences. To provide reliable and absolute TDN products to our customers, Ambush finally succeeded on using of SOLENOID mechanism. The biggest advantage of adopting SOLENOID TDN mechanism is that Optical Low Pass Filter and Glass would automatically switch only upon certain level of light without any other sources. Even though many customers were satisfied with our previous TDN cameras in the past, Ambush's goal is to come across best security solution for our customers Using Metal Lens Holder and button type of Line Lock adjustment also increases reliability of security cameras. Lower Power Consumption Is absolutely helpful, since it's related to camera's lifetime. Besides, achieving very Wide Operating Voltage Range, 2nd video output, and Dip Switch provides friendly and easy installation.

What is a True Dynamic Mechanism?
For a camera to called a TRUE Day & Night unit, it needs to feature some key engineering components. Without these core mechanical elements, it is only imitating a True Day & Night Camera. Here is a list of core features of a True Day & Night Camera:


Unique Design of True Day & Night Mechanism - SOLENOID

TRUE DAY NIGHT (TDN) Function using Solenoid TDN Mechanism exists only at Ambush. OLPF filter and Glass can be switched upon certain level of light without any other influence.
Only light level makes this mechanism to work. Also it's very reliable, being able to withstand even at high temperature since it uses LCP material that endures over 200¡É.


Controlling Processor of TDN mechanism-
MICOM Chipset


MICOM, Ambush's own technology, is a Main Chipset for TDN camera. MICOM continuously controls and adjusts Gamma and iris level upon certain external light condition. Meaning MICOM judges the timing for the camera from switching Color to BW or vise versa.

 

Color Killing Function
This function is recommended when TDN is not being used because it helps camera performance at low illumination. By controlling the burst perfectly, the camera changes to BW mode and achieves clear images with higher sensitivity.
